In-Depth Analysis

Businesses in Cherry Willingham, a built-up area (BUA) within West Lindsey, Lincolnshire, generally benefit from a lower crime rate compared to the national average. The area has a population of 3942 and a crime rate of 37.1 incidents per 1,000 residents, significantly below the UK average of 91.6 per 1,000. This translates to a safety score of 92 out of 100, exceeding the UK average of 79.

While the overall crime rate is reassuring, retail businesses still face challenges common to any location. Specific data on types of retail crime in Cherry Willingham is not readily available, but based on general trends, potential challenges could include shoplifting, employee theft, and fraud. The relatively low crime rate suggests that these incidents may be less frequent than in areas with higher crime figures, but proactive security measures remain vital.

It’s important to note that a lower crime rate doesn't imply a complete absence of risk. Opportunistic theft can still occur, and businesses should implement preventative measures. These can range from visible security presence (such as CCTV) to robust staff training focused on identifying and preventing theft.

Considering the area's demographics and relatively low crime rate, businesses should focus on preventative measures that are cost-effective and proportionate to the risk. Regularly reviewing security protocols, conducting staff training, and maintaining a visible presence can contribute to a secure retail environment. While specific details of retail crime incidents within Cherry Willingham are unavailable, adopting best practices for security and loss prevention remains a worthwhile investment for all businesses.
